According to a news report on 2nd September, “One of Cornwall’s leading developers has submitted its plans to deliver hundreds of much-needed homes for the county.” [Cornish Times]. This application is for 550 new dwellings in Wadebridge.

So are these ‘much-needed homes' or not? Lets look at housing development history in and around the town.
Context
Between 2011 and 2021 the number of dwellings increased from 3,151 to 3,450. Of these unoccupied numbers rose from 196 to 295, (8.6% of the 2021 total) of which 95 were second homes.
All Household spaces | Occupied | Unoccupied | |
2011 | 3151 | 2955 | 196 |
2021 | 3450 | 3150 | 295 |
Change nos | 299 | 195 | 99 |
Change % | 9.5 | 6.6 | 50.5 |
[Census, 2011 and Census 2021].
Between 2012 and 2021, planning permission for 654 dwellings was given of which 457 were for open market dwellings.
Since then applications for another 543 dwellings have been made.
Commentary
Therefore the recent application for 550 dwellings is in addition to the 543 already in the pipeline. That’s a total of 1,093 new dwellings. An increase of 32%! Why?
Such an increase is not required. The annual increase in Occupied housing numbers between 2011 and 2021 was 20 a year. Unoccupied dwellings increased by 10 per annum.
The majority of new dwellings are ‘open market’ dwellings, which are unlikely to be affordable and therefore available to local residents.
The Home Choice Register* gives a total of 270 households with a local connection for Wadebridge, lower than the number of unoccupied dwellings in the town.
[* The number on the register does not equate to the number of new dwellings required to be built].
